Meta is seeking a Director and Associate General Counsel to join the Legal department’s Corporate Governance team. The successful candidate is expected to operate independently in a fast-paced environment and work proactively with various teams across the organization, including executive operations, human resources, and finance.

Director & Associate General Counsel, Governance Responsibilities:

  • Advise on governance best practices for public company’s independent board of directors and executive management, including relevant aspects of Delaware Law and listing standards.
  • Provide input and direction on materials provided to the board of directors and ensure proper maintenance of books and records.
  • Work closely with cross-functional partners on board compliance and development initiatives.
  • Direct efforts to maintain corporate formalities in accordance with best practices.
  • Develop, enhance and maintain board policies and practices.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ional partners on board and executive compensation matters.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• J.D. degree.
  • 12+ years of relevant legal experience.
  • Membership in at least one state bar.
  • Experience in interpretation and application of Delaware law.
  • In-house Corporate legal and Governance support of Fortune 500 public company board of directors.
  • Experience leveraging organizational skills and strategic thinking, and experience working with cross-functional teams.
  • Experience related to legal issues pertaining to executive compensation and related disclosure.
  • Experience working with other subject matter experts in all facets of governance including talent management and HR.
  • Superior communication skills with attention to detail.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Prior experience with a Fortune 100 company.
  • Prior experience with AmLaw 100 law firm.
  • Deep expertise in interpretation and application of Delaware law.
  • Extensive work related to legal issues pertaining to executive compensation and related disclosure. Regular interactions with C-suite.
  • 5+ years in-house experience working with independent public company boards.
  • Demonstrated record of increasing responsibility and interaction with executive management.
